The Senior Transportation Programs is a not-for-profit, social service
program that was started in 1978 by CICOA Aging and In-Home Solutions(an
Area Agency on Aging) to address the transportation needs of
individuals, age 60 or older, to enhance their continued well-being and
independence.

The program provides transportation services for approximately 2,000 senior citizens, which includes
persons who are physically mobile, those whose sole means of mobility is a wheelchair, and those who
are indigent.

The program utilizes the following combination of transportation services to meet the needs of
the senior community:
The
Taxi Discount Program which issues taxi discount coupons to senior citizens enabling
them to access public taxi transportation any hour of the day, and any day of the week;
The
Wheelchair Transportation Program issues vouchers good for wheelchair transportation
anywhere in Marion county. The service is provided by Yellow Cab Wheelchair Service;
The
Essential Needs Transportation Program utilizes volunteer & staff drivers,
to transport senior citizens to doctors' offices, clinics, hospitals, government
services, or shopping for food and other necessary items;
and, a
Grocery /Shopping Shuttle Service which provides daily, time based transportation for
twenty (20) senior apartment complexes to grocery stores and shopping centers. The
program coordinates with the City of Indianapolis transit system, and other not-for-profit
agencies.

All of these services are designed to address the problems caused by lack of transportation,
including isolation and limited access to needed services. Consumers have opportunities to
provide input on these programs, both by frequent individual contact with program staff, and
through the annual survey process. The program receives funding from Federal tax sources i.e.
The Older Americans' Act and State tax sources i.e. The Older Hoosiers' Act. The funds are
administered through CICOA The Access Network. United Way of Central Indiana, and private donations also fund the
programs. Client donations are generous and key sources of donated income because clients
know the value of the programs and participate in financing it.
